Emir of Ilorin urges more attention on security studies

Date: 2012-03-13

The Emir of Ilorin,Kwara State, Alhaji Ibrahim Sulu-Gambari, has charged participants of the Executive Intelligence Management Course 5 of the Institution of Security Studies, Abuja, to use their knowledge and wealth of experience in addressing the security challenges facing the country.

Alhaji Sulu-Gambari gave the charge while receiving a team of the course participants who paid him homage at his palace.

He stressed the need for the study group to explore the state and utilise its findings for the betterment of Nigerians.

The Emir, who described security services as very interesting but challenging task, said the course participants should justify the confidence reposed in them by their respective agencies during and after the programme.

He said gone were days when Nigerians could sleep outside their houses overnight without fear of armed robbery attacks, regretting that section 419 of the Criminal Code has become a Nigerian language of fraud and high profile corruption at all levels.

The traditional ruler attributed the prevailing security threats in the country to the aftermaths of the civil war of 1967, stressing that Nigeria could surmount her shortcomings with the support and steadfastness of all.

He prayed God to grant the team His blessings to accomplish its set objectives.

Earlier, the leader of the team, Mr Musa Baba, had told the Emir that they were at his palace to receive his royal blessings for a successful study tour, adding that the team comprised nine course participants drawn from security agencies, and regulatory agencies, among others.

He stressed that other participants are also undertaking their study tours of Kaduna, Nassarawa, Abia and Akwa Ibom states, noting that the purpose of the exercise is to assess the situation of things and report to the institute for necessary action.

The team leader, who is a directing staff of the institute, said the participants are expected to be agents of change in their various establishments after the nine-month course, whose theme, according to him, is "National security and the transformation agenda."

Other areas visited by the team include Power Holding Company of Nigeria (PHCN) 330/132/33 KV Ganmo Power Sub-station, the University of Ilorin School of Preliminary Studies, Fufu and Pepele Waterworks in Ilorin East Local Government Area of the state.
